发明名称 |
一种同构层次数据对比可视分析方法和应用 |
摘要 |
本发明公布了一种同构层次数据对比可视分析方法和应用,用节点‑链接法中的同构树表达层次结构,结合平行坐标进行布局,使得在展现数据的层次化关系的同时还可进行数据的对比分析;包括:对数据进行预处理,得到多个异构层次数据集;基于多个异构层次数据集,通过结构整合和减枝,抽取同构信息建立同构树;通过布局算法对同构树进行布局;结合同构树布局与平行坐标系,在展现数据的层次化关系的同时还可进行数据的对比分析。本发明支持对各节点属性值的对比分析,包括最大和最小值、属性值高低的分布模式和变化趋势、属性之间的关联等,可应用于对食品安全领域中多国MRL数据进行可视化。 |
申请公布号 |
CN106227828A |
申请公布日期 |
2016.12.14 |
申请号 |
CN201610591178.7 |
申请日期 |
2016.07.25 |
申请人 |
北京工商大学 |
发明人 |
陈谊;董禹;孙悦红 |
分类号 |
G06F17/30(2006.01)I;G06Q50/02(2012.01)I |
主分类号 |
G06F17/30(2006.01)I |
代理机构 |
北京万象新悦知识产权代理事务所(普通合伙) 11360 |
代理人 |
黄凤茹 |
主权项 |
一种同构层次数据对比可视分析方法,用节点‑链接法中的同构树表达层次结构,结合平行坐标进行布局,使得在展现数据的层次化关系的同时还可进行数据的对比分析;包括如下步骤:A)对数据进行预处理,得到多个异构层次数据集;B)基于多个异构层次数据集,通过结构整合和减枝,抽取同构信息,建立同构树;C)通过布局算法对同构树进行布局,所述布局算法将与根节点相连的一族子树称为一个子树簇,统计同构树中每个子树簇的叶子节点个数,按照叶子节点个数从多到少排序,将叶子节点个数最多的子树簇称为第一个子树簇,将所述第一个子树簇布局在图形中央,剩余的子树簇按照叶子节点个数从多到少依次排列在所述第一个子树簇的上下两端;D)结合C)所述同构树布局与平行坐标系进行数据可视化,具体将平行坐标的列抽象显示为不同层次结构叶子节点的值,由此建立同构树布局与平行坐标系之间的关联;再增加一列用来显示不同数据的属性值;由此使得在展现数据的层次化关系的同时还可进行数据的对比分析。 |
地址 |
100048 北京市海淀阜成路33号 |